The ICMA Book Prize – Call For Applications

The ICMA invites submissions for the annual prize for the best single-authored book on any topic in medieval art. Books that will be considered need to be printed in 2015. No special issues of journals or anthologies or exhibition catalogues can be considered.

The prize is international and open to any author; ICMA membership is not required to be considered for the prize.

Languages of publication: English, French, German, Italian, or Spanish.

Jury 2016: Nancy Patterson Ševčenko, Helen Evans, David Raizman, Gerald Guest

Prize money for the author: US $1,000.
